1881 Boston mayoral election
The Boston mayoral election of 1881 saw the election of Samuel Abbott Green.

Results
Party | Candidate | Votes | % | |
---|---|---|---|---|
Republican | Samuel Abbott Green | 20,429 | 50.86% | |
Democratic | Albert Palmer | 19,724 | 49.11% | |
Others | Scattering | 14 | 0.04% | |
Turnout | 40,167 |
